Tirupati Cultural Immersion Itinerary (July 2023)

  1. Day 1: Tirumala Venkateswara Temple
    10 minutes (2.3 km) from Tirupati Railway Station

    The Tirumala Venkateswara Temple is one of the most famous pilgrimage destinations in India. The temple is dedicated to Lord Venkateswara, an incarnation of Lord Vishnu, and is believed to be one of the oldest and richest temples in the world. Get an early start to avoid the crowds and witness the morning Abhishekam ritual. Spend the afternoon exploring the temple complex and learning about its rich history and religious significance. In the evening, witness the captivating Ekanta Seva, a ritualistic prayer that marks the temple's closing hours.

  2. Day 2: Sri Kapileswara Swamy Temple and Sri Venugopala Swamy Temple
    20 minutes (6.7 km) from Tirumala Venkateswara Temple

    Start the day by visiting the Sri Kapileswara Swamy Temple, a temple dedicated to Lord Shiva and located at the base of the Tirumala hills. After offering your prayers, head over to the Sri Venugopala Swamy Temple, a temple dedicated to Lord Krishna. Take in the temple's beautiful architecture and serene atmosphere. In the afternoon, immerse yourself in the local culture by visiting the Sri Kalahasti Temple, a temple dedicated to Lord Shiva and known for its stunning architecture and intricate carvings.

  3. Day 3: Sri Govindarajaswami Temple and Chandragiri Fort
    15 minutes (4.2 km) from Sri Kapileswara Swamy Temple

    Begin the day by visiting the Sri Govindarajaswami Temple, a temple dedicated to Lord Vishnu and located in the heart of Tirupati. Take a stroll through the temple's ornate halls and marvel at its stunning architecture. In the afternoon, visit the Chandragiri Fort, a historic fort located atop a hill. Explore the fort's ruins and learn about its rich history. End the day by enjoying a traditional South Indian meal at one of Tirupati's local restaurants.

Recommendations

If you're interested in learning more about the local culture, consider visiting the Sri Venkateswara Museum or attending a classical dance or music performance at the Sri Venkateswara Kala Mandir. If you have time, take a day trip to the nearby town of Srikalahasti, known for its ancient temple and stunning natural beauty.

Time and Costs Estimates

  • Tirumala Venkateswara Temple (4-5 hours, free)
  • Sri Kapileswara Swamy Temple (1-2 hours, free)
  • Sri Venugopala Swamy Temple (1-2 hours, free)
  • Sri Govindarajaswami Temple (1-2 hours, free)
  • Chandragiri Fort (1-2 hours, INR 50 per person)
  • Meals (INR 200-300 per person per day)
  • Total Estimated Costs: INR 50-350 per day per person
